engine mount location

any one have measurements on where to loacate the engine mounts on a alpha 1 gen 1. Distance to center from transom and side to tide with standard merc mounts.

It depends upon what engine you are using. I swapped a 4.3L to a 5.7L in my boat, and the mounts went forward 4". I think SBC and BBC are same location, but I am not sure.

If you are using a SBC, I could measure mine if it helps you.

My stringers were not full length, so I added stainless steel C channel to make them full length. Dropped the motor in, then drilled and bolted the mounts down to it.

You could also relocating plates from a Chevy S-10 V6 to V8 conversion kit if you wanted to make no changes. I decided to just use the channel.
